New exercise routine aims to ease arm stiffness after heart device surgery

NCT ID NCT07494825

First seen Jun 27, 2026 · Last updated Jun 27, 2026

Summary

This study will test a structured exercise program for the arm on the side where a heart device (like a pacemaker) was implanted. The goal is to see if it safely improves arm movement, reduces pain and stiffness, and boosts quality of life. About 600 adults who need or already have a heart device will take part and be followed for up to 12 months.
